    Adani Skills & Education (ASE), the skill development arm of the Adani Group, has launched Karma Shiksha, a Work-Study Diploma Program under the National Council for Vocational Education & Training (NCVET), Ministry of Skill Development & Entrepreneurship (MSDE).

    Designed for Class 10 and 12 pass students across all streams as well as ITI graduates, Karma Shiksha blends classroom learning with hands-on industry experience across Adani’s core sectors including ports, power, solar manufacturing, green energy and logistics.

    The program offers a two-year diploma in Ports Management and Logistics Management, with NCVET-recognised certification jointly awarded with ASE. Students selected through a national-level merit process will benefit from a stipend, multi-sector exposure, and pathways to higher education, including lateral entry into degree programs.
